Discovered prior to road construction (Excavation Licence No. 00E0794). Excavation of an area 50m x 40m area led to the discovery of two Neolithic Structures (LH021-072---- and LH021-078----), a cobbled surface (situated between the two structures) and approximately 40 pits (LH021-079----). This structure was smaller in size (6m x 5.1m) and better preserved than the other (LH021-072----) which was located 9m to the S. Its outline was marked by a foundation trench which varied in depth from 0.14m to 0.04m and contained remnants of burnt planks. Three postholes, two pits and a possible hearth were identified in the interior along with a number of sherds of Neolithic pottery. (Ó Drisceoil 2002, 214-5)
